From: Crystal structure and biophysical characterization of the nucleoside diphosphate kinase from Leishmania braziliensis

Lb NDK hexamer interfaces. (A) Side and top views of the hexamer, with each subunit in a different color (red, orange and cyan in the bottom trimer; purple, yellow and green in the top trimer). (B) Dimeric interface regions from two different subunits (purple and cyan) with an inset corresponding to the zoom view that shows residues (sticks) involved in dimer stabilization via hydrogen bonds (dotted black lines) and the electronic density map for these residues. (C) Trimeric interface region between the purple and green subunits highlighting residues (sticks) that make hydrogen bonds (dotted black lines) and the electronic density map for these residues.
